Stickney was also home to crime boss and pizza maker Alfonso Tornabene also known as 'Al the Pizza Man.' Tornabene was a high-ranking member of the Chicago Outfit who founded Villa Nova pizzeria in 1955, a favorite local pizza spot. Unfortunately, Villa Nova doesn’t deliver this far north, but believe me when I tell you it’s well worth it to call ahead and pick one up, or better yet, have it in the retro ’50s dining room. The array of pizza toppings has increased, too, to include the more trendy choices such as spinach and pineapple, but the mainstay is still their consistently good cheese or sausage pizza. Five employees have grown to 50, and the menu has expanded to contain a number of pasta dishes and various other sandwiches. Tornabene retired in 1988 when he handed Villa Nova down to his daughter, Mary, and her husband, Sonny Adamczyk, who successfully run the business today.
